Statistics indicate that approximately 328.77 million terabytes of data are generated daily. This immense volume of information holds priceless insights that empower governments, businesses, and organizations to forecast future trends, comprehend target audiences, and make data-driven decisions.
To harness this data, employers seek skilled data scientists—often referred to as data gurus—who have the ability to interpret intricate data, pinpoint valuable insights, and present them clearly to non-experts.
Recruiters typically look for a blend of technical and soft skills in data science candidates, helping them select the right fit for their company needs. Whether you are an aspiring or seasoned data scientist, mastering these skills and adapting to industry changes is imperative for success.
This article outlines the top 15 data scientist skills that employers are eager to find in potential candidates. It also provides guidance on how you can develop these skills to excel in your career.
Essential Technical Skills for Data Scientists
Programming Languages
Data scientists must be proficient in multiple programming languages to effectively manipulate and analyze data. Although many programming languages exist, Python, R, SQL, Scala, and Java top the list among data science professionals.
A strong command of these languages is necessary for extracting meaningful insights from data and making impactful decisions.
Big Data
With the explosion of data, expertise in big data technologies is crucial for gathering, storing, processing, and analyzing insights from diverse datasets. Data scientists should master big data analytics techniques.
An understanding of machine learning algorithms, data mining methods, and statistical techniques enables data scientists to uncover patterns, trends, and correlations within complex data environments.
Statistical Analysis
Data science fundamentally revolves around using algorithms and statistical methods for understanding data. Data scientists apply their statistical and probabilistic knowledge to predict future behaviors and provide strategic recommendations to business leaders.
They excel at identifying trends, forecasting outcomes, and recognizing outliers in data patterns, which is critical for informed decision-making.
Machine Learning (ML) and Artificial Intelligence (AI)
In the contemporary data landscape, proficiency in AI and ML is invaluable. ML, a subset of AI, focuses on creating algorithms that learn tasks independently without extensive coding.
Expert data scientists employ various methodologies, including supervised and unsupervised learning, utilizing diverse tools to analyze vast datasets and devise adaptive solutions.
Data Collection, Transformation, and Loading
These essential processes in data management involve collecting data from multiple sources, transforming it into an analyzable format, and storing it in databases or data warehouses.
This skill ensures data integrity and accessibility, allowing analysts to derive insights and support informed decision-making. Mastery of these processes is vital for effective data analysis.
Data Structures and Algorithms
Proficiency in data structures and algorithms is crucial for data scientists in analyzing and interpreting complex datasets.
This knowledge allows them to design efficient and scalable solutions, necessary for managing large data volumes, optimizing machine learning models, and resolving complex data analysis issues.
Data Wrangling
Data wrangling entails refining raw data by cleaning, transforming null values, and eliminating anomalies to prepare it for analysis across different platforms.
Mastering data wrangling techniques allows data scientists to integrate varied data forms, facilitating efficient transfers of large datasets to analytical tools for trend detection.
Data Visualization
Data scientists must convey complex data in an easily digestible format, aiding non-technical stakeholders like shareholders and marketers in their decision-making processes.
To achieve this, they utilize effective visualization tools, including graphs, charts, maps, and platforms such as ggplot, Qlik Sense, Power BI, and Tableau, which allow them to create impactful data representations.
Database Management
Adeptness in managing, maintaining, and accessing large volumes of data is essential for data scientists. Familiarity with database management principles enables efficient information retrieval from organizational databases.
As data scientists navigate multiple company databases, knowledge of various management tools and systems becomes critical for effective data storage, manipulation, and analysis.
Website Scraping
Website scraping is a valuable skill for data scientists, enabling them to extract data from web pages. This process involves gathering specific information from websites, often aimed at compiling large datasets from publicly accessible sources.
Proficiency in web scraping tools and methods allows data scientists to automate data collection, which is essential for comprehensive analysis and trend identification.
Mathematics Skills
Advanced mathematics is essential for data scientists in constructing machine learning models and addressing complex problems. Key mathematical areas include linear algebra, calculus, probability, regression, and vector models.
Proficiency in these topics is critical for effectively applying algorithms in real-world scenarios.
Model Building and Deployment
This skill involves developing and implementing predictive models that convert data into actionable insights.
It includes selecting suitable algorithms, training models on datasets, and evaluating their performance. Once optimized, these models are deployed in production environments to automate decision-making processes.
Such expertise ensures data scientists can create reliable and scalable models that address challenges and add value to their organizations.
Business Acumen
A strong understanding of the business context is crucial for data scientists. This skill involves comprehending industry dynamics, goals, and challenges, enabling them to align analyses with strategic objectives.
Seeing the overall picture ensures that data-driven solutions remain relevant and impactful.
Communication
The ability to articulate complex data insights in accessible language for non-technical stakeholders is vital.
Effective communication bridges the gap between data science and business strategy, enabling companies to make informed decisions and enhancing overall data literacy within the organization.
Critical Thinking
Data scientists must critically assess assumptions, analyze data sources, and challenge findings to ensure accuracy. This skill is essential for uncovering real insights and driving objective outcomes.
Problem Solving
Data scientists encounter various challenges daily, and strong problem-solving skills are key to tackling these efficiently.
This involves decomposing issues into manageable parts and applying analytical techniques to develop solutions, often requiring creativity and a thorough understanding of data and algorithms.
Intellectual Curiosity
A genuine interest in exploring new questions, learning new techniques, and staying informed about emerging trends is vital for data scientists.
This continuous quest for knowledge keeps them at the forefront of technological advancements and analytical methods, allowing them to apply innovative solutions to data challenges.
Teamwork
Effective collaboration with engineers, business leaders, and product managers is crucial. Data scientists must work within teams to synthesize insights and integrate models into operational processes.
How to Develop Essential Data Scientist Skills
1. Academic Foundation
Begin with a strong educational background in mathematics, statistics, computer science, or a related field. Obtaining a bachelor's or master's degree significantly enhances your understanding of complex data science concepts.
2. Technical Proficiency
Become proficient in programming languages like Python or R, essential for data manipulation and analysis. Familiarize yourself with SQL for database interactions and delve into machine learning frameworks to build models.
3. Practical Application
Apply your knowledge through hands-on projects. Start with simple datasets to practice cleaning, analyzing, and visualizing data, then tackle more complex challenges. These projects not only enhance learning but also build a portfolio to showcase your skills to potential employers.
4. Continuous Learning
The field of data science is rapidly evolving, making it vital to stay updated on the latest technologies, algorithms, and best practices.
Online courses, workshops, and webinars can elevate your skillset. Engage in data science competitions on platforms like Kaggle to challenge your knowledge and learn from peers.
5. Soft Skills Development
Alongside technical competencies, focus on enhancing soft skills. Practice presenting your findings to diverse audiences to refine your communication abilities.
Collaborate on projects to foster team skills and cultivate intellectual curiosity by exploring various datasets. Improve critical thinking by questioning assumptions and validating hypotheses.
6. Networking and Mentorship
Connect with the data science community through meetups, conferences, and online forums. Networking opens doors to industry insights and job opportunities. Seek mentorship from experienced professionals for guidance and career advice.
Showcasing Your Data Science Skills at Workplace
Effectively demonstrating your data science skills at work includes:
- Leading data-driven projects: Initiate projects leveraging your data science skills to achieve business goals.
- Presenting insights effectively: Convert complex data findings into actionable insights for non-technical audiences.
- Contributing to team discussions: Provide data-backed recommendations and fresh perspectives during team meetings.
- Staying updated: Recurring education in new tools and techniques is key.
- Demonstrating technical abilities: Consistently apply your expertise in data analysis, machine learning, and predictive modeling in your day-to